I just flew the New Alliance Yesterday and it was upgraded with the Naish Smart Loop.

The Smart loop cleans up you bar a lot, no more adjuster strap, no more toggles, and the biggest advantage, easy adjustment from the base of your chicken loop, no more leaning forward to de-power your kite, meaning you can keep your weight on your edge and maintain control whist adjusting.

The Smart loop retro kits arrived yesterday, so they will be available at your local dealers Monday/Tuesday (east coast, or Friday west (to those that ordered them)). A Definate worth while upgrade in my opinion.

Another big benifit is you only have to replace the TRIM LINE if you wear the rope out, cheaper and easier than replacing the whole chicken loop.

The Golden tip when setting up any bar, is to ensure that all your lines are even when the bar is fully powered up (i.e. unhooked and at it's maximum power setting). I suggest setting the Smart loop to full power, lay your lines out (untangled) and put a screw driver through the ends. Then set you back lines to a knot were all your lines tension up at the same time when you pull on the bar. This is the best starting point for all kites.

The Smartloop was always an option with the Naish 2008 range, we used and tested the Smartloop back in June in Maui. Unfortunately the Factory fell behind in producing the Smartloop in time for the early release. Southern Hemisphere countries had the choice to either wait until late October and get SMARTLOOP, or get kites in August with std loop. We choose Std loop and early delivery, but the price of the kite was changed accordingly (i.e. the kite is cheaper with std loop) SO no-one is ripped off, some people shop on a budget, if they are happy with the standard loop then they can get on a SIGMA kite for a cheaper price, to those that want all the bells and whistles, the upgrade kit will bring the kite to the price you would have paid (with the discount now available, see the next post, or info on the Main forum) if we did order all the kites with SMART LOOP.

Unfortunately items like the SMARTLOOP and IRONHEART are made of components from many different manufacturers, and it only takes one item to delay release of a product. It is always a dream to have all products ready on time, and available, but when were talking about 2008 model products getting out onto the market as early as Sept. 2007, I think there doing pretty well.
